Mechanism of Action
Mechanism of action
Zuclopenthixol is a neuroleptic from the thioxanthenes family.
It acts by blocking dopamine receptors
It also has alpha atropinic and sympatholytic effects.
Clinically, zuclopenthixol is a neuroleptic that is characterized by an antipsychotic and anti-hallucinatory effect, as well as a sedative effect.
